Rock of Ages 2: Bigger & Boulder rolls onto the Nintendo Switch

May 15, 2019 by Andrew Newton

Rock of Ages 2: Bigger & Boulder is now available on the Nintendo eShop and developers Ace Team has ensured this sequel ensures that players have more of the boulder crushing/ tower defence monty python-esque fun of the original.  Watch the new launch trailer below….

Rock of Ages 2: Bigger & Boulder finds the Greek Titan Atlas in a bit of a pickle so players will need to guide him through different periods of art history to help him escape the consequences.

Players will be able to race through a variety of beautiful looking levels crushing and destroying obstacles in order to smash open the enemy gateways, this can be done in single player or co-op play with up to 3 friends. There’s also the ability to take on friends in a little friendly competition if you think you’re too good for the AI.

Rock of Ages 2: Bigger & Boulder features:

  • Play with up to four players online in competitive matches and customise the banners and colours for your boulder.
  • Expands on the first game with the addition of a more diverse selection of units and a larger focus on rock-smashing strategy.
  • Improved physics and destructible environments allowing players to crack, crush, slam, and flatten their opponents.
  • ACE Team’s trademark quirkiness that will see players rock and roll through the ages meeting and killing famous historical and mythological figures.
  • Take on various works of art as they come to life in boss battles that feature the likes of The Thinker and the Great Sphinx.

Start the boulder running with Rock of Ages 2: Bigger & Boulder on the Nintendo eShop now, priced £13.49.
